Bukit Kutu Hike


Bukit Kutu is a mountain located near Kuala Kubu Baru, Selangor along the main road to Fraser’s Hill. Standing at 1,053 meters, it was once known as a colonial hill station named "Treacher’s Hill", before being overshadowed by the more popular Bukit Fraser. Despite being referred to as “Bukit”, which translates to “Hill” in Malay, the hike takes about 3 to 4 hours, featuring some steep sections.
During the war, it was bombed by the Japanese and subsequently left to nature, causing the access road (once used for cart rail) to become overgrown with thick vegetation. Currently, the remnants of the bungalows that once had a view of the lush valley consist of a chimney, fireplace, and a well (which still collects water), along with the stone walls on the opposite side of the ridge. On weekends, it becomes a favored climbing destination, offering stunning views of the Titiwangsa mountain range and the Kuala Kubu Bharu dam at its summit.
The hike up Bukit Kutu (which takes 2 to 4 hours depending on pace) starts from an Orang Asli village at the base; make a right turn at the sign for Kampung Pertak after the Sungai Selangor Dam, if you are coming from the town of Kuala Kubu Bharu. Proceed along the paved road past contemporary Aborigine homes as it follows the Sungai Pertak river, where the route transitions to gravel. Continue until reaching the culmination at the river junction with a suspension bridge. Follow the 4WD path until it encounters another river segment with a partly submerged bridge; cross it and continue along the trail until reaching a serene river section. Wade across and take the first left turn until reaching a fork; turn right, and the path will be clearly marked beyond this point, steeply ascending after crossing all the stream sections.
